Git:如何设置SSH密钥以从第二台计算机访问我的远程存储库?

时间:2010-07-02 10:01:22

标签: git ssh msysgit

我在Unfuddle上有一个git存储库,还有一个我正在使用msysgit的Windows机器。我使用ssh-keygen在该机器上设置了一个SSH密钥,它给了我一些关键文件。我将公钥文件的内容复制到我的Unfuddle帐户中的个人设置中,并且工作正常。

那么我需要做些什么才能让它在第二台机器上运行?如果我按照相同的过程,我将不得不将新公钥放入我的Unfuddle帐户,因此可能旧机器将停止工作。有什么方法可以让我的第二台机器使用与第一台机器相同的钥匙?

谢谢, 格兰特

2 个答案:

答案 0 :(得分:4)

1 /如果是同一个用户,您可以将~/.ssh/id_rsaid_rsa.pub复制到其他计算机主目录。

或:

2 /您应该可以将另一个公钥注册到您的未解决的帐户,允许您为每台计算机管理一个私钥。

答案 1 :(得分:0)

只需使用相同的私钥即可连接第二台计算机,如果它们都在您的控制之下。